A missing tooth is more than just an inconvenience or an embarrassing gap in your smile. They may be small, but your pearly whites play a huge role in your daily life, your health, and even your life expectancy. Studies show that people who are 65 and older and have lost five or more teeth are more likely to suffer from systemic health conditions like cardiovascular disease and diabetes. Other studies have found that patients with 20 or more teeth by the time they’re 70 years old have a considerably higher chance of living longer than those with less than 20 teeth.
